Redis集群安全存储与取值(redis集群存储和取值)
Redis集群是一种灵活、可用性高、支持高并发且安全存储的NoSQL数据库。它是一种完全分布式的,可以让你把数据(例如缓存)在多台服务器上分布存储。然而,使用的服务器的安全和可靠性也是一个重要的问题,然而,通过Redis集群可以构建可靠的数据存储系统,以确保数据的安全和可靠性。
Redis集群提供了一种可以赋予足够安全性的方式来实现安全和可靠的数据存储。在这种方式中,每台服务器都存储所有数据,确保每个服务器都存在关键数据以及准确的备份。通过这种方式,使得Redis可以提供可靠的、安全的数据存储。
此外,Redis集群还支持数据的取值,只要在客户端向服务器发送一个GET命令,就可以返回指定的数据。取值的方式有一般获取,以及事务。通过一般获取的方式,客户端可以获取相应的值,而事务的取值则可以让客户端同时发送多个请求,执行完毕之后再执行回滚操作。
Redis集群提供了开发人员强大可靠的工具,它可以帮助他们来构建可靠安全的数据存储系统,从而让应用程序拥有更高的可用性和可靠性。例如,可以添加以下方法用于从Redis集群中安全取值:
//Get data from Redis cluster
public static String getDataDromRedisCluster(Jedis jedis){
String key = “key”;
String value=””;
try{
jedis.watch(key);
value=jedis.get(key);
jedis.unwatch();
}catch(JedisConnectionException e){
System.out.println(“请检查Redis集群的连接是否正常!”);
}
return value;
}
Redis集群可以帮助开发人员构建可靠安全的数据存储系统,从而提高系统可用性和可靠性。虽然取值和存储数据都需要特定的技术,但通过Redis集群可以确保安全取值和安全存储,从而更好地满足开发人员的需求。